Public Meeting: Public transit project in your community

The future of transit in your community is changing. Metrolinx and the Region of Waterloo are moving forward with plans for the future King Victoria Transit Hub, and we want your input. The transit hub will connect ION, GRT, GO, VIA, pedestrians and cyclists in one convenient location. It will connect to the Toronto-Waterloo innovation corridor and provide opportunities for community and economic development.

The project team is committed to a fair, open, transparent process involving both community and business.

Please join staff from City of Kitchener, Metrolinx and Region of Waterloo for an update on plans for your neighbourhood, which will include information about the potential future closure of Duke Street. Representatives will be available to answer your questions and collect your feedback.
